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Soledad South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Soledad South with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Soledad South is at Emerald Manor Apartments listed at $2,595.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Soledad South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Soledad South is $4,224.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Soledad South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Soledad South is a 1,272 square feet unit starting from $4,995 at Casas by the Sea.

What is the average size for Soledad South 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Soledad South is currently 1,148 sq ft.
